- The distance between Kunduz, Afghanistan and Mariehamn, Åland Islands, Finland is approximately 4,309 km or 2,678 mi.
- To reach Kunduz in this distance one would set out from Mariehamn, Åland Islands bearing 104.7°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Kunduz bearing 143.1° or SE .
- Kunduz has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Mariehamn, Åland Islands has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- The mean temperature is 11.5 °C (20.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.2 °C (14.8°F) more in Kunduz.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 235.4 mm (9.3 in) less which is equivalent to 235.4 l/m² (5.78 US gal/ft²) or 2,354,000 l/ha (251,658 US gal/ac) less. About 4/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23.4° higher in Kunduz than in Mariehamn, Åland Islands.
- Relative humidity levels are 20.9%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 4.8°C (8.6°F) higher.
